[quote=Anonymous]I think you are being far too influenced by your husband and not taking this seriously enough. Your daughter needs to be evaluated by an eating disorder specialist in addition to looking at OCD/ADHD/Anxiety/Autism and other alphabet soup diagnoses. As you meet with these specialists, you need to be prepared for them to suggest that you pull this kid out of school. This sounds like a serious mental health crisis and she may refuse meds. Perhaps you won’t need this, but you and your husband need to get very serious about the fact that your child’s life may be on the line. Missing a semester of school may be the least of her/your concerns. I am wishing nothing but the best for you. But you may need to overrule your husband here. If he is saying no to stuff, just go do as much as you can without him. There are times when you have to do the right thing over the other parent’s objection. [/quote]
